The Map

Where LGBTQ+ Atlanta
Actually Lives

"Atlanta" here means the metro — the Midtown core, Decatur's storied lesbian hub, East Atlanta's queer creative scene, and a six-million-person region whose LGBTQ+ population share ranks among the highest of any major U.S. metro.

The Core
Midtown

The center of gravity — the bars, the festival footprint, Piedmont Park and the Pride parade route down Peachtree. Midtown is also the tech-and-finance corridor whose CEI-scoring employers supply the protections Georgia's statute book does not.

Intown
Decatur & East Atlanta

Decatur is the South's storied lesbian hub and home to Charis Books & More, the region's oldest feminist bookstore (1974). East Atlanta carries the younger, artier, drag-and-nightlife scene that WUSSY Mag speaks to — where cultural credibility is earned, not bought.

The Defining Community
Black Queer Atlanta

Not a segment — the market's defining community. Reached through its own events, promoters, creators and media: Atlanta Black Pride and Pure Heat, Southern Fried Queer Pride, NAESM and THRIVE SS. Budget for this layer, or reach half the market.

Institutional anchors across the metro include Georgia Equality (the statehouse opposition and the force behind the municipal-ordinance layer), the Phillip Rush Center — the community's shared home for dozens of organizations — Grady's Ponce de Leon Center and AID Atlanta on the HIV frontline, Lost-n-Found Youth, Out Front Theatre, and the National Center for Civil and Human Rights.

A snapshot from the LGBTQ+ Atlanta Regional Guide — a perfect-score city inside a state with no civil-rights law, and the fall calendar that comes with it.

#1

The World’s Largest Black Pride

Atlanta Black Pride Weekend draws 100,000+ every Labor Day, anchored by the free Pure Heat Community Festival in Piedmont Park. Nowhere else do movement history, Black life and queer life braid this tightly.

350K

A Pride That Lands in October

Atlanta Pride draws 350,000+ visitors each October, timed to National Coming Out Day — giving brands a second Pride season after the national one ends, and the country’s best Q4 LGBTQ+ inventory.

100

The Only 100 in Georgia

Atlanta holds a perfect Municipal Equality Index score — the only Georgia city to do so, an eleven-plus-year streak built entirely from municipal action, with no state non-discrimination law contributing a single point.

The Atlanta Calendar

The Fall the Whole
Country Comes South

Atlanta's calendar is unique — its two biggest LGBTQ+ moments land in September and October, not June, giving brands a second Pride season when national inventory has already cleared.

September 2–7 (Labor Day)
Atlanta Black Pride Weekend — the largest Black Pride in the world, 100,000+ strong, anchored by the free Pure Heat Community Festival in Piedmont Park.
September 24 – October 4
Out On Film — the Oscar- and BAFTA-qualifying LGBTQ+ film festival, now in its 39th year and one of the South's most significant cultural properties.
October 8–12
Atlanta Pride — 350,000+ visitors, the Peachtree parade into Piedmont Park, timed to National Coming Out Day and among the nation's largest free Prides.
Year-Round
The benefit circuit — the HRC Atlanta Dinner (among HRC's largest nationally), Joining Hearts, Toy Party and AIDS Walk Atlanta, where the Southeast's corporate and community leadership actually mixes.
Spring & Summer
Southern Fried Queer Pride and the neighborhood drag, ballroom and event calendar that keeps the market active well outside the fall season.
